Gold Fields first landed on the scene with an emphatic, electronic thud in 2011 with a super hyped self-titled EP and a critically acclaimed debut album Black Sun in 2013, and are promising a return to their tribal infused synth-pop jams this year, albeit with a slightly darker edge. These run of shows with KLP will be their first Aussie shows in nearly two years after sowing their seeds across the globe, including a hectic US tour.
Known across the country as the host of Triple J's House Party each week, KLP is more than just your average deck-hound, with mad dog producer and vocalist skills combining to make her a force to be reckoned with. Having impressed us most recently with a joint single with Brisbane producer Young Franco Talkin' Bout It, and a rightfully rowdy KLParty DJ Tour, Kristy Lee seems destined to reign over the Aus scene for quite sometime and we can't wait for her full live set next month.
